BILL TO BAN RED 40 IN SCHOOLS PROGRESSES THROUGH TN LEGISLATURE

A bill in Tennessee (HB 0134/SB 0476) is progressing through the state legislature to ban items containing Red 40, a food dye, from being sold or provided to students on school property, except during fundraising events.

Introduced by Rep. Elaine Davis and Sen. Janice Bowling, the bill amends Tennessee Code Annotated, Title 49, and applies to Local Education Agencies (LEAs) and public charter schools.

It has been recommended for passage by a House subcommittee and the Senate in March, with further discussion scheduled for April 3 in the House Calendar & Rules Committee. If passed, the prohibition would begin on August 1, 2027.
